show location-service
Displays information and statistics for all location services or for a specific location service.
Product
MME
SGSN
Privilege
Security Administrator, Administrator, Operator, Inspector
Command Modes
Exec

Syntax Description
show location-service { service { all | name service_name } | statistics { all | service service_name } [ | {

service { all | name service_name }
Display configuration information pertaining to location services.
all: Displays information for all location services.
name service_name: Displays information only for an existing location service specified as an alphanumeric
string of 1 through 63 characters.

statistics { all | service service_name }
Display statistics pertaining to location services.
all: Displays statistics for all location services.
name service_name: Displays statistics only for an existing location service specified as an alphanumeric
string of 1 through 64 characters.
